Roanoke
Roanoke is the Star City of the South, named for the enormous illuminated star on Mill Mountain that's been lighting up the valley since 1949. The Blue Ridge Parkway runs right past town. The downtown has come back beautifully with the Taubman Museum, breweries, and a thriving market. The surrounding mountains are gorgeous in every season. Smaller and more scenic than people expect.

Huntsville is Rocket City, with NASA's Marshall Space Flight Center, the Saturn V rocket on display at the Space and Rocket Center, and a tech and engineering economy that punches way above the city's size. Cummings Research Park is the second-largest research park in the U.S. The Tennessee River and Monte Sano State Park give it a quiet outdoor side. Affordable and surprisingly smart.
